AS A sign of the changing nature of engine technology, Jaguar is due to introduce the most powerful version of its XF range – this time powered by diesel.

The XF Diesel S has a 275bhp 3.0-litre diesel unit offering an impressive 600Nm of torque and a 0-100km/h time of under six seconds. Emissions are 179g/km with a fuel consumption figure of 6.7 L/100km, making it more efficient and more powerful than the current 2.7 litre V6 diesel.

Prices have yet to be confirmed but the new car is due in Ireland in early spring.
